Mathematical properties form the foundational framework that Grade 8 students need to master as they advance through increasingly complex mathematical concepts. These comprehensive flashcards available through Wayground help students develop strong recall and understanding of essential properties including the commutative, associative, and distributive properties, as well as properties of equality, identity elements, and inverse operations. The flashcard format enables students to systematically review key concepts and build the memory pathways necessary for automatic recognition of these fundamental mathematical relationships. Through repeated practice with these vocabulary-rich resources, students strengthen their ability to identify, apply, and explain mathematical properties across various problem-solving contexts, creating the conceptual foundation needed for algebraic thinking and advanced mathematical reasoning.
